SCENE OF THE DAY:
The Guru Nanak College of Education selected the four
branches of Guru Harkishan Public School that are located at India
Gate, Nanak Piao, Punjabi Bagh and Tilak Nagar for Preliminary
School Engagement (PSE). The students are allotted schools for
PSE as per the location of their residence/suitability. Fortunately, I
get GURU HARKISHAN PUBLIC SCHOOL, INDIA GATE, NEW
DELHI for my PSE Training which was near to my residence.
The situation that I want to share was held at outside of the
class 10th “C” in balcony of the 2nd floor of the school after the
lunch break when I was going for my substitute period.
DISCRIPTION OF THE WHOLE SITUATION:
When I was going for my substitute period then I saw bunch of
students gathered around in the balcony of the second floor at
outside of classroom of Class: 10th”C” . With none of time wasting I
rushed to know the whole situation. I saw two boys were fighting as
well as abusing with each other. All other students were gathered
around and watching them fighting. None of the student was
compromising among them rather than they only watching them
fighting.

REFLECTION:
According to my view, I want to suggest that the students are
the future of tomorrow and we should nourish them properly. So, we
should listen and pay attention to them. In the above situation, I
politely asked them to keep aside and narrate the reason behind the
fight. Both told their part of the story to me. Then I politely handle
the whole situation and compromise between both boys. At last, both
boys shake hands with each other and apologize for the misdeeds to
each other. They “Thank” me and promised me for not fighting
their after and proceed for their respective class.

I personally listened to both boys and eliminate their


misunderstanding and guide them softly. So, both boys pay attention
to me and follow/agree my views. I want to give the reader the
message about how to tackle these types of situations that “We
should listen, pay attention and guide them softly.”
